Florence
Florentia, “the florid”, was the name given by the Romans to this small settlement located at the foot of the ancient Etruscan Fiesole. Legendary as a city of flourishing art and culture since the thirteenth century, this Renaissance capital is a monumental center with splendid musical offerings. The theaters, palaces, auditoriums, and churches that grace Florence’s hallowed streets can only be described as ethereal, and the musical tradition that has grown and refined itself here over the centuries is incomparable. It is almost impossible to find a nook in Florence’s stunning (and easy-to-navigate) historical center that contains no architectural gem; this opulent and storied home of the Medici dynasty is still one of the most dazzling spots in the western world – a place to be savored with the ears as well as the eyes.
